Makerlog features and specs

  • Community-Driven
    Makerlog offers a supportive and active community of makers and developers where users can share their progress, get feedback, and find motivation.
  • Simple Task Management
    The platform provides an easy-to-use interface for tracking daily tasks, making it straightforward for users to log their work and monitor progress.
  • Accountability
    Users can hold themselves accountable by publicly logging their tasks, which can increase productivity and help them stay on track.
  • Integration with Other Tools
    Makerlog supports integration with various tools such as Slack, Twitter, and Zapier, allowing for seamless workflow and task management.
  • Gamification Elements
    The platform includes gamification features like streaks and achievements, which can motivate users to maintain consistent progress.
  • Free Basic Plan
    Makerlog offers a free plan with basic features, making it accessible for those who want to try it without financial commitment.

Possible disadvantages of Makerlog

  • Limited Features in Free Plan
    Some useful features and integrations are locked behind the premium subscription, which may be a drawback for users not willing to pay.
  • Focused on Makers
    The platform is specifically tailored for makers and developers, which may not make it ideal for users outside this niche.
  • Basic Task Management
    While simple and easy to use, the task management functionality might be too basic for users who need more advanced project management tools.
  • Dependency on Community Interaction
    A significant part of the platform's value comes from community interaction and support, which might not appeal to users who prefer working in isolation.
  • Platform Stability and Updates
    As with many niche platforms, there might be occasional issues with stability or delays in updates and new features.

JavaScripting features and specs

  • Access to a Large Library
    JavaScripting provides access to a vast collection of JavaScript libraries, frameworks, and plugins, offering developers an extensive range of tools to enhance their projects.
  • Time-Saving
    Developers can save time by finding pre-existing solutions to common problems, allowing them to focus more on unique aspects of their applications.
  • Community Contributions
    The platform is supported by a community of developers who contribute and update libraries, ensuring you have access to the latest tools and trends.
  • Ease of Use
    JavaScripting is designed with a user-friendly interface that simplifies the process of searching and accessing JavaScript libraries.

Possible disadvantages of JavaScripting

  • Quality Variability
    The quality of libraries can vary as they are community-contributed, meaning it can be challenging to find consistently high-quality or well-documented solutions.
  • Dependency Management
    Using multiple third-party libraries can lead to complex dependency management, potentially causing conflicts or bloat in your project.
  • Security Concerns
    Incorporating third-party libraries may introduce security vulnerabilities if libraries are not well-maintained or reviewed regularly.
  • Overlapping Functionality
    The large number of available libraries can lead to redundancy, with multiple libraries offering similar functionalities, which may confuse developers choosing the right tool.
